A multi-valve assembly designed for immediate, coordinated fluid release in emergency quenching applications.

Its multi-valve design enables immediate, coordinated fluid release, while stainless steel construction and PTFE/Viton seals ensure durability and leak resistance under high-pressure emergency conditions.
The body and actuator are stainless steel for corrosion resistance, seals and gaskets are PTFE/Viton for chemical compatibility, and internal fittings are brass/copper for optimal fluid flow and durability.
Through its manifold block design that synchronizes multiple poppet/seal assemblies and solenoid/pneumatic actuators, allowing simultaneous operation of all valves for uniform quenching coverage.
